Abstract
The characterization of the amplitude and delay response of superstructure fiber Bragg gratings was discussed. The periodic superstructure fiber Bragg gratings are characterized by a periodic variation of the grating parameters resulting in a multiband spectra response arising from every Fourier component of the superstructure. The modeling of the superstructure using the coupling-mode theory and the Runge-Kutta method for solving Riccati equations is discussed.
